This is the basic teaching of Wallace D. Wattles, the man whose 100 year old book inspired the mega-selling "The Secret" and the whole Law of Attraction thing going on today.

When I read his book it blew me away.  I know I may sound like one of those "prosperity" people, but damned if I didn't see the light with this book. This is not a "think happy thoughts and all will be well" book. This book challenges you to follow through, all the way, everyday. But the rewards are tremendous.

Where was this book my whole life? Ok, so maybe I was not ready for it before this moment. I tried all the other ways, "get a good job and you'll be happy" blah blah blah and here I was unemployed, no prospects and deeply in debt. What did I have to lose?

Wattles proposed a tested, scientific way to get rich. It was the total opposite of how I believed you had to make money. Instead of a limited supply from which we all grab before someone else does, Wattles said the Universe is infinitely abundant and you will, must, get rich by doing things in such a way that leaves others with MORE.
